云南公路隧道建设成就与展望

摘要: 为促进云南公路隧道工程建设中工程技术和创新成果的推广和应用,总结归纳了三十余年来云
南公路隧道的建设成就,以芹菜塘、杨林、虎跳峡地下立交、富龙K15 棚洞、老营及毛栗坡等典型隧
道工程为例,阐述了连拱及分岔、软岩大变形、高地震烈度、半暗挖棚洞、超大断面等隧道技术的最
先创新成果及研究进展,回顾了云南公路隧道施工技术的发展历程,同时对近年来云南公路隧道施工
理念、工艺工法的创新与发展做了论述。基于云南公路隧道发展现状,针对建设、养护及运维中亟待
解决的技术难题,指出了云南公路隧道在隧道钻爆法不良地质处治和机械化施工、TBM/盾构工法应
用、信息化与智能化技术应用、预防性养护与装备技术等方面存在的不足,提出了应重视隧道检测,
加强隧道科学养护和运营管理,延长使用寿命,提高服务水平的建议;以期为云南公路隧道的高质量
发展提供有益参考。

关键词: 公路隧道, 建设成就, 典型工程, 设计技术, 施工技术

Abstract: In order to promote the promotion and application of engineering technology and
innovative achievements in the construction of Yunnan highway tunnels, this paper summarizes
and summarizes the construction achievements of Yunnan highway tunnels over the past thirty
years. Taking typical tunnel projects such as Qincaitang, Yanglin, Hutiaoxia underground overpass,
Fulong K15 shed tunnel, Laoying and Maolipo as examples, this paper elaborates on the arch and
bifurcation, large deformation of soft rock, high seismic intensity, semi concealed excavation shed
tunnel The first innovative achievements and research progress in tunnel technology such as super
large cross-section were reviewed, and the development process of Yunnan highway tunnel
construction technology was reviewed. At the same time, the innovation and development of
Yunnan highway tunnel construction concepts and processes in recent years were discussed.
Based on the current development status of Yunnan highway tunnels, and in response to the urgent
technical problems in construction, maintenance, and operation, this paper points out the
shortcomings of Yunnan highway tunnels in the treatment of unfavorable geological conditions
through tunnel drilling and blasting, mechanized construction, TBM/shield tunneling application,
information and intelligent technology application, preventive maintenance and equipment
technology, and proposes that attention should be paid to tunnel inspection, scientific maintenance
and operation management of tunnels should be strengthened, and service life should be extended,
Suggestions for improving service levels; To provide useful references for the high-quality
development of Yunnan highway tunnels.

Key words: Highway tunnel, Construction achievements, Typical engineering, Design technology, Construction technique
